A plaque located at the entrance to Pioneer Cemetery in Grand Canyon National Park.

he plaque says, "In Memory of those who gave their lives serving our country
World War I
Arthur N. Blower
John Ivens
Ashley Wilson
World War II
John K. Dowling
Ernest Haly VI
Robert T. Kishi
Stetson Pahonyeoma
George F. Scheck
Erected by
John Ivens Post No. 42
American Legion
Grand Canyon, Arizona
November 11, 1948"
